18-20 125 STREET
18-20 125 STREET is a Class B2 (two-family frame) building in Queens (BBL 4041300030) built in 2000, with 2 residential units across 2 floors.
The building is in NYC community district 407, council district 19, zoning district R4A, on a 2,900-square-foot lot with a building footprint of 2,100 square feet.
The current registered owner of record per NYC PLUTO is QU, XIONG.
The most recent ACRIS deed transfer for this BBL was recorded on November 1, 2024 when Chen, Song Ping conveyed the property to Qu, Xiong for a non-disclosed consideration. The transaction was recorded as cash (no paired mortgage instrument).

What is the assessed value of 18-20 125 STREET?
NYC Department of Finance assesses 18-20 125 STREET at $74K for the current tax year. NYC assesses property at a fraction of estimated market value (the assessment ratio varies by tax class — 6% for tax class 1 one-to-three-family dwellings, approximately 45% for tax class 2 rental apartment buildings), so the market value implied by this assessment is meaningfully higher. Assessment data is published by NYC Department of Finance.
